Nature of the problem
The victim's syndrome in psychology is a condition in which a person completely loses interest in life. Such a person can sit in four walls for years and not be interested in anything. From the side it looks as if a person is constantly immersed in depression, experiencing mental pain, is in a state of hopelessness.
Victim's syndrome does not allow individuals to show their best qualities of character, to nurture existing abilities and talents. Instead of the future, a large question mark looms, and ahead there is only emptiness and suspense. Such a person does not know what he wants and does not imagine how to achieve any goals. Do not ignore him and the difficulty in communication. People, feeling the individual’s weakness, do not miss the chance to laugh at him or say another offensive word.
Sometimes there is a real situation when a person becomes a victim of abuse. In truth, he attracts the attention of the offender with his inability to show will, character, response. Often, people form a victim syndrome on their own. They are sitting at home, not interested in anything, hiding behind their complexes and fears.

Strict parents
Each problem has its own beginning. The origins of victim syndrome go deep into childhood. As a rule, those who suffer from this problem once had very strict parents. They did not allow the child anything superfluous, constantly put forward unrealistic demands and scolded for mistakes. Over time, the child learned to perceive himself from the position of a limp creature.
